BatteryStatsViewer UI improvements:

1. DEVICE and ALL_APPS are now combined in one screen
2. Totals are displayed at the top
3. Column headers are shown conditionally
4. New icon for totals
5. Swipe-to-refresh

Bug: 187370721
Test: mp :BatteryStatsViewer && adb shell am start -n com.android.frameworks.core.batterystatsviewer/.BatteryConsumerPickerActivity

Change-Id: Ic250fe54b3fe3c54ff461218f126fc83f9921fd9
10 files changed